Mipomersen is a second-generation antisense oligonucleotide used as an adjunct to diet and other lipid-lowering medications for the treatment of homozygous familial hypercholesterolemia (HoFH), a rare genetic disorder characterized by extremely high cholesterol levels. It works by binding specifically to the messenger RNA (mRNA) encoding apolipoprotein B-100 (apoB-100), the main protein component of low-density lipoprotein cholesterol (LDL-C) and very low-density lipoprotein cholesterol (VLDL-C). This binding leads to RNase H-mediated degradation of apoB-100 mRNA, thereby inhibiting translation and reducing production of apoB-containing lipoproteins, including LDL-C, VLDL-C, and Lipoprotein(a). Mipomersen is administered via subcutaneous injection. The drug was developed by Ionis Pharmaceuticals and marketed under the brand name Kynamro. Due to risks of hepatotoxicity, its use is restricted under a Risk Evaluation and Mitigation Strategy program[2][3][5][6][7].
